Covalent bonding is important between atoms of biological molecules, but other factors are important for self-assembly. For exam

ple, hydrogen bonds between base-pairs in DNA hold the two strands together.

The biomolecules are the macromolecules composed by the polymerisation of small units called monomers. Since the biomolecules are the molecules in which both the covalent and noncovalent bonds are present.

Both covalent and non-covalent bonds stabilize the structure of the biomolecule like in DNA the phosphodiester bond between the two nucleotides but the DNA also contain the non-covalent bonds like hydrogen bonds between the base pair which allows the complementary base pairing a stabilizes the helical structure of DNA.

Leaves are adapted for photosynthesis and gaseous exchange.

They are adapted for photosynthesis by having a large surface area, and contain openings, called stomata to allow carbon dioxide into the leaf and oxygen out. Although these design features are good for photosynthesis, they can result in the leaf losing a lot of water. The cells inside the leaf have water on their surface. Some of this water evaporates, and the water vapour can then escape from inside the leaf.

When water evaporates from the leaves, resulting in more water being drawn up from the roots, it is called transpiration.

To reduce water loss the leaf is coated in a waxy cuticle to stop the water vapour escaping through the epidermis. Leaves usually have fewer stomata on their top surface to reduce this water loss.

Leaves enable photosynthesis to occur. Photosynthesis is the process by which leaves absorb light and carbon dioxide to produce glucose (food) for plants to grow. Leaves are adapted to perform their function, eg they have a large surface area to absorb sunlight.

Plants have two different types of 'transport' tissue, xylem and phloem. These specialised tissues move substances in and around the plant.

What happens to the mRNA before it comes to the ribosome?
Marina CMI [18]

Answer:

Explanation: RNA is made in the nucleus.  It is a single stranded copy of DNA.  It gets edited by removing the introns (non coding region) and  keeping the exons (coding region).  The mRNA now leaves the nucleus to be read by the ribosomes.
